Go to Customiz’it! > Front Page
Front Page can point to either a Static Page or your Latest Posts. So there are a few combinations that can be set (Home & Blog refer to Pages):
1) Front page displays: Don’t show any posts or page
2) Front page displays: your latest posts =Displays posts
3) Front page displays: A static Page
Posts page: –Select–
Front page: –Select– =Displays posts
4) Front page displays: A static Page
Posts page: –Select–
Front page: Home =Displays static page
5) Front page displays: A static Page
Posts page: Blog
Front page: –Select– =Displays posts
6) Front page displays: A static Page
Posts page: Blog
Front page: Home =Displays static page
You need to use option 4 (No posts) or 6 (Posts).
Create a new Page called Home (for example) in Dashboard>Pages>Add New.
Add a bit of text (eg Lorem…) to prove to yourself it works.
You then can write HTML, and the best approach is to base it on Twitter Bootstrap 2
